University of Adelaide – Allied Health

Design

To support their Physiotherapy Program, the University of Adelaide engaged Brown Falconer for the first stage of the New Allied Health Program.  We delivered one purpose built Rehabilitation Gym located in Hughes Level 1 and one Practical and Workshop Training space located in Helen Mayo North Level 2. Both spaces have ample open floor space for gait training and to incorporate various specialty equipment, with significant consideration given to acoustic separation to the surrounding offices.

The University’s brief was for a space that was light and airy, with a “wellness retreat” atmosphere. Consideration to biophilic elements were incorporated providing a calming feel. The spaces are reflective of real life practice and have ample storage to accommodate a variety of speciality instruments. We ensured there was a connection between the spaces, ensuring a common palette that translated across the school.
